There will be a ICS 400 class - Advanced ICS, Command and General Staff-Complex Incidents – held on July 24 – 25, 2010 at Calvert City Hall, 1315 5th Ave., Calvert City, KY 42029.
This Advanced Incident Command System, Command and General Staff-Complex Incidents course provides training on and resources for personnel who require advanced application of the ICS. This course expands upon information covered in ICS 100 through ICS 300 courses.
The Target audience for this class is Law Enforcement, Emergency Medical Services, Emergency Management Agency, Fire Service, hazardous materials (HAZMAT), Public Works, Government Administrative, Public Safety Communications, Health Care, and Public Health.
Prerequisites for the ICS 400 is designed for emergency responders who have successfully completed the ICS-100, ICS-200, ICS-300, IS-700 or IS-700.a, and IS-800 courses offered by the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A) or the Center for Domestic Preparedness (CDP). Command or General Staff experience is also required.
